Discover the profound connection between literature and the environment in Steinbeck and the Environment by Susan F. Beegel. Published by The University of Alabama Press in 2007, this insightful paperback spans 384 pages, exploring the significant influence of John Steinbeck's fascination with ecology and marine biology on his literary works. Beegel delves into how Steinbeck's environmental awareness shaped his narratives, offering readers a unique perspective on the interplay between nature and storytelling. This book is essential for anyone interested in understanding the ecological themes that permeate Steinbeck's writings.
